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.163 Beiträge
 
Delphi 12 Athens
 
#5

AW: TDateTimePicker mit modus Time kennt die Zeit nicht

  Alt 13. Jun 2022, 21:19
Was ist denn nun so schwer?

Du willst nur die Zeiten vergleichen .... also vergleiche doch auch nur die Zeiten und entferne das Datum.

Trunc und Frac würde ich aber hier nicht verwenden,
auch wenn es mathematisch das Gleiche macht, wie Delphi-Referenz durchsuchenDataOf und Delphi-Referenz durchsuchenTimeOf.
"Logisch" macht es was Anderes und so ist der Code auch selbstdokumentierend.
[edit] CompareTime verwendet intern natürlich auch TimeOf [/edit]


Bzw., wenn du nur die Zeit haben willst, warum liest du dann nicht nur die Zeit aus?
Delphi-Referenz durchsuchenTDateTimePicker.DateTime
Delphi-Referenz durchsuchenTDateTimePicker.Date
Delphi-Referenz durchsuchenTDateTimePicker.Time



Alternativ kann man auch zu Beginn (OnCreate) Delphi-Referenz durchsuchenNow bzw. Delphi-Referenz durchsuchenDate in den TDateTimePicker eintragen.
So lange dann niemand zu lange zum Auswählen braucht und Mitternacht verschläft, dann passt es ja noch zusammen.
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ests

Geändert von himitsu (13. Jun 2022 um 21:22 Uhr)
  Mit Zitat antworten Zitat